npm 包 bunyan-live-logger 使用教程

阅读时长 3 分钟读完

在前端开发过程中,日志记录是非常重要的一环,对于一些复杂的应用程序,日志能够帮助我们快速定位问题并给出解决方案。而 npm包 bunyan-live-logger 可以帮助我们更加便捷地记录和查看日志。

什么是 Bunyan-live-logger?

bunyan-live-logger 是一个基于 Bunyan 日志系统的 npm 包,用于在实时 Web 界面中直接捕获和显示应用程序的 Bunyan 日志。我们可以在任意已有的应用程序中使用 bunyan-live-logger,尤其适用于需要在开发期间进行日志捕获和解决问题的应用程序。

如何安装 Bunyan-live-logger?

安装 bunyan-live-logger 就像安装其他 npm 包一样简单。你可以在你的项目目录下执行以下命令:

或者全局安装:

如何使用 Bunyan-live-logger?

bunyan-live-logger 具有简单的 API,你只需要在你的代码中添加以下代码块即可:

-- -------------------- ---- -------
----- ------ - ------------------------------
----- ------ - ------------------

----- -------- - --------  -- ------

-- -------
----- --- - ---------------------
  ----- --------
  ------ --------
---

----------- ------ ----------  -- --------------- ------------------

上述代码将创建一个名为 myapp 的日志记录器和实时 web 界面,你可以在其中查看和轻松分析应用程序的日志输出。

如需查看 web 界面,只需运行以下命令:

然后打开 http://localhost:8080 来查看你的日志。

Bunyan-live-logger 的指导意义

bunyan-live-logger 是一个非常强大的日志工具。在实践中,我们必须保持日志记录信息的直观性,使用 bunyan-live-logger 可以轻松解决这个问题。

同时,bunyan-live-logger 提供了一个很好的学习机会,通过查看输出日志,我们可以更好地理解应用程序运行过程中的发展历程。并且,bunyan-live-logger 还提供了一个方便的跟踪工具,可用于追踪 bug 和优化程序性能。

示例代码

-- -------------------- ---- -------
----- ------ - ------------------------------
----- ------ - ------------------

----- -------- - --------

----- --- - ---------------------
  ----- --------
  ------ --------
---

----------- ------ ----------

---------------- ------
-------------- ------
----------------- ------
---------------- ------
---------------- ------

运行 bunyan-live-logger 命令,然后在 http://localhost:8080 查看日志输出。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066c8eccdc64669dde56b1

纠错
反馈